British Basketball League: Surrey Heat go second with victory over Sheffield Sharks
Sunday 14 October 2012 20:13, UK
Surrey Heat inflicted a fourth straight loss on One Health Sharks Sheffield with a 79-63 victory in Sunday BBL action.
Glasgow Rocks registered their first home win of the season by edging Manchester Giants 88-85 to reach the BBL Cup quarter-finals. It was always looking like it would go until the last few seconds and so it proved. However, the Giants and Devan Bailey in particular, will be disappointed at missing far too many free-throws, the guard missed four in a row inside the last two minutes and it proved to be costly. EJ Harrison was the star performer for the Rocks and fittingly, he was the man with the composure during crunch time to get the Rocks safely over the line and set up a last eight encounter at Sheffield.
